BMS 182874 hydrochloride
BMS 182874 hydrochloride is an orallyactive, highly selective endothelin receptor (ETA receptor) antagonist, with IC50 value of 0.150 μM, Ki of 0.055 μM. BMS 182874 hydrochloride reduces the arterial pressure of Deoxycorticosterone acetate (HY-B1472) induced hypertension model in rats, and can be used for cardiovascular disease research.

Biological Activity
BMS 182874 hydrochloride (dimethyla minoanalogue 11) is an antagonist of the ETA ,with IC50 value of 0.150 μM and Ki of 0.055 μM in vsm-A10 cells, and with a KB value of 0.520 μM in rabbit carotid artery rings[1].
